A speaker candidate may expend campaign funds for:
- (1) travel for the speaker candidate and the speaker candidate's immediate family and campaign staff;
- (2) the employment of clerks and stenographers;
- (3) clerical and stenographic supplies;
- (4) printing and stationery;
- (5) office rent;
- (6) telephone, telegraph, postage, freight, and express expenses;
- (7) advertising and publicity;
- (8) the expenses of holding political and other meetings designed to promote the candidacy;
- (9) the employment of legal counsel; and
- (10) the retirement of campaign loans.
Acts 1985, 69th Leg., ch. 479, Sec. 1, eff. Sept. 1, 1985.
